Beaufort Academy volleyball earned another big region win Tuesday, sweeping visiting Thomas Heyward Academy.
The Eagles rolled to a 25-12, 25-15, 25-13 victory behind another strong performance from Chase Vaigneur, who collected 15 kills, eight digs, six assists, and four aces in a well-rounded effort.

Claire Tumlin also had a solid evening with 11 assists, nine digs, and three kills, and Mary Hanna Hiers was the defensive stalwart for BA with 23 digs to go with three kills and five assists to help BA bounce back from a 3-1 loss to Colleton Prep on Monday.
Keleigh Bowers tried to keep THA in it with eight kills, seven digs, and two blocks, while Sydney Butler added 13 digs and two blocks. A pair of young players led the Rebels at the serving line, as freshman Lucy Dantzler was 11-for-11 with three aces, and eighth-grader Brooke Smith was 10-for-10 with an ace and 17 digs.
The Eagles (6-3, 3-3) host Hilton Head Prep at 5:30 p.m. Thursday, while the Rebels (2-9, 0-5) host Colleton Prep at 6 p.m. Thursday.
